Q: Is 160,207,121 a Prime Number?
A: No, 160,207,121 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 160207121 can be evenly divided by 1 23 43 529 989 7,043 22,747 161,989 302,849 3,725,747 6,965,527 and 160,207,121, with no remainder.
Since 160,207,121 cannot be divided by just 1 and 160,207,121, it is not a prime number.
